JOB TITLE: Medical Secretary Team Lead
GRADE: Band 4
HOURS: 37.5 hours (part time applications considered)
CONTRACT: Permanent
LOCATION: Cambridge Street House Day Unit
We are searching for a creative and forward thinking individual to oversee the delivery of administrative support within the South West Adult Mental Health Team. You will be leading an experienced admin team in providing support to the multi-disciplinary clinicians and support workers based at Cambridge Street House in areas such as Psychiatry, CMHT Nursing, Psychology and Thrive.
Working as part of this multi-disciplinary team, your role will be to ensure both efficiency and quality of administrative and secretarial support to service users, colleagues and partner agencies accessing our services. You will be responsible for developing local procedures/systems and managing our service waiting lists as well as ensuring the site is covered administratively. You will line manage and support a team of committed admin staff, comprising medical secretaries and a receptionist, and provide ongoing supervision/appraisal to support their development.
The successful candidate should be highly motivated, proactive and organised, with strong communication skills and experience of working at a senior secretarial/administrative level. A commitment to the NHS Lothian Values and quality provision in healthcare is essential for this post.
Whilst this post is full time, applications for part time working will be considered within reason.
The Day Unit is based in Edinburgh City Centre near Castle Terrace and the Usher Hall with very good public transport links for buses and trams.
